We provided sustainability due diligence and climate resilience advisory for airport PPP projects, including the USD 2.5 billion NAIA transaction and six regional airport bundles. Our work covered climate risk and vulnerability assessment, mitigation and adaptation planning, decarbonisation opportunities, and the integration of sustainability requirements into bankable airport infrastructure projects.

The Civil Aviation Decarbonization Organization (CADO) was created to maintain and operate the IATA-developed SAF Registry. EC-Impact is member of the Registry with an Intermediary account, which means we can facilitate the redemption of fuel units on behalf of owners.
